Gross Profit: RMB 28.3 million, a 10.2% increase from RMB 25.7 million in Q2 2024, with a gross margin improvement to 50.6% from 49.6%.
Operating Expenses: RMB 42.1 million, down 9.4% from RMB 46.5 million in Q2 2024, leading to a reduction in operating loss to RMB 13.7 million from RMB 20.8 million.
Net Loss: RMB 10.8 million, improved from RMB 16.8 million in the prior year.
First Half Performance: Total net revenues increased by 11.8% to RMB 111.7 million, with a gross profit of RMB 53.7 million, up 12.8%.
Growth Drivers: Significant revenue growth attributed to overseas study counseling, research-based learning, and other educational services, which collectively rose over 50%.
Enrollment Trends: Total student enrollment decreased by 3.1% to 1,050, attributed to normalized demand post-pandemic.
Project-Based Programs: Increased contribution from project-based programs, which accounted for 76.7% of total credit hours delivered, reflecting a shift in student preferences.
New Initiatives: Introduction of various new programs, including master classes and themed travel camps, aimed at enhancing student experience and engagement.
2025 Revenue Forecast: Expected total net revenues between RMB 276 million to RMB 281 million, representing a 3% to 5% increase year-over-year.
Focus Areas: Continued emphasis on portfolio training as a revenue pillar, with plans to enhance existing offerings and introduce new services.
Enrollment Decline: The 3.1% drop in total student enrollment indicates potential challenges in attracting new students amid a competitive landscape.
Increased Competition: Noted intensified competition in the creative arts education sector, which could impact market share and pricing strategies.
Operational Losses: Despite narrowing losses, the company still reported significant operational losses, highlighting ongoing financial pressures.
